10 Iconic St. Louis Restaurants Everyone Should Visit

St. Louis boasts a rich culinary scene, blending tradition with innovation. Here are ten iconic restaurants that everyone should explore:

  1. Pappy’s Smokehouse: Renowned for its Memphis-style BBQ, Pappy’s is famous for slow-smoked ribs that fall off the bone.

  2. Tony’s: An institution in Italian dining, Tony’s offers classic dishes and a warm, family-friendly atmosphere, perfect for a special occasion.

  3. The Crossing: This farm-to-table eatery emphasizes seasonal ingredients with innovative dishes that highlight local produce.

  4. Ted Drewes Frozen Custard: A St. Louis staple since 1929, Ted Drewes serves creamy frozen custard, famously sold in a cup turned upside down.

  5. Eleven Eleven Mississippi: Known for its wine selection and artisanal pizzas, this unique venue is set in a historic building with a charming ambiance.

  6. The Hill: While not a single restaurant, this neighborhood is famous for its Italian eateries. Places like Charlie Gitto’s and Zia’s offer authentic Italian dining experiences.

  7. Blueberry Hill: A vibrant music venue and diner, Blueberry Hill is famous for its burgers and a rock ‘n’ roll history that attracts music lovers.

  8. Niche Food Company: Focused on fresh, local ingredients, Niche offers a rotating menu that showcases the best of St. Louis’s culinary talent.

  9. Farmhaus: This upscale restaurant emphasizes sustainable practices, offering dishes that reflect the changing seasons.

  10. Gioia’s Deli: Famous for its hot salami sandwich, Gioia’s has been serving delicious deli fare since 1918.

Each of these restaurants encapsulates the spirit of St. Louis, making them must-visit spots for both locals and tourists.
